Factors Affecting Comprehensive Coverage Rates
Several key factors can influence the cost of comprehensive car insurance in the UK:
1. Vehicle Make and Model
The type of vehicle you drive significantly impacts your insurance rates. High-performance or luxury vehicles tend to have higher premiums due to their increased repair costs and theft risk.
2. Driver's Age and Experience
Insurance companies often consider the age and driving experience of the policyholder when determining rates. Young and inexperienced drivers typically face higher premiums due to their perceived risk.
3. Location
Your postcode plays a vital role in the cost of comprehensive coverage. Urban areas with higher crime rates may see increased premiums compared to rural locations where theft and accidents are less common.
4. Driving History
A clean driving record can lead to lower insurance rates. Drivers with previous claims, accidents, or traffic violations may experience higher premiums as they are viewed as higher risk.
5. Annual Mileage
The distance you drive each year can affect your premiums. Lower annual mileage can lead to reduced rates, as it decreases the likelihood of an accident.
6. Security Features
Vehicles equipped with advanced security features, such as alarms, immobilisers, and tracking systems, often qualify for discounts on comprehensive coverage. These features reduce the risk of theft and damage.

Tips for Reducing Comprehensive Car Insurance Rates
Here are some strategies to help decrease your comprehensive insurance premiums:
- Increase your excess: By agreeing to pay a higher excess in the event of a claim, you may lower your premiums.
- Maintain a clean driving record: Safe driving can lead to no-claims discounts and lower rates over time.
- Consider telematics policies: These insurance policies, monitored by a device or app, reward safe driving habits with lower premiums.
- Join a car insurance group: Some organisations offer discounts to members, which can lead to savings.
